The Challenge of Legacy Systems
If your business has been running for more than 5 years, chances are you're dealing with at least one system that's showing its age. These legacy systems were built for a different era—before cloud computing, before mobile devices, and before your business grew to its current size.
Common Signs Your System Needs Modernisation
- Slow performance that frustrates your team
- Frequent crashes or downtime
- Can't find support because the technology is outdated
- Can't integrate with modern tools your competitors are using
- Security concerns with old, unpatched software
- Recruitment challenges because nobody wants to work with old tech
- High maintenance costs for decreasing reliability

3. Phased Implementation
We don't do big-bang migrations. Instead:
- Phase 1: Quick wins and foundation work
- Phase 2: Core functionality migration
- Phase 3: Advanced features and optimisation
- Phase 4: Final cutover and decommissioning
Each phase is tested, validated, and approved before moving forward.

Real-World Example
Professional Services Firm (Removed for Privacy)
A 20-year-old law firm was running a custom practice management system built in 2010. The original developer had retired, and the system was showing its age.
Our Approach:
- Assessed the system and identified core vs. nice-to-have features
- Built a cloud-based replacement in stages
- Migrated data gradually with extensive validation
- Ran both systems in parallel for 3 months
- Trained staff in small groups over 2 months
- Decommissioned the old system only after full validation
Result: Smooth transition with zero data loss and minimal disruption.
